ATHENS — The Portsmouth Lady Trojans appear to be focused on something. Oh yeah. A state championship.

Making the girls’ basketball Final Four a second straight season, Portsmouth downed the Fairland Lady Dragons convincingly 63-40 and will now play for the Division 5 state championship against Norwayne in a 10:45 tip-off at the University of Dayton Arena.

Norwayne (25-3) beat Columbus Aftricentric 49-40.

Portsmouth (26-1) was led by Sienna Allen and Daysha Reid with 20 points each and Keke Woods with 10 points. Allen also had 9 rebounds while K.K. Mays had 5 boards.

Fairland (21-6) suffered from a cold shooting performance. The Lady Dragons made only 13 of 47 shots from the field for 27.6 percent and 7 of 23 from behind the arc for 30.4 percent.

Addyson Cornell scored 10 points with Isa Taliaferro and Bailey Russell netting 8 points each. The Lady Dragons were averaging more than 65 points a game.

After Reid hit a 3-pointer to start the game, Taliaferro answered with a triple of her own and the game was tied at the 6:33 mark.

Portsmouth then took off as Allen sank 2 free throws, Reid hit another trey, Woods made a layup and Allen made a layup and a long 3-pointer and the lead was 15-3.

Russell’s 3-pointer at the 2:37 mark put a halt to the run but Portsmouth finished the quarter with a 7-2 run and it was 22-8.

The Lady Trojans continued to distance themselves as they outscored Fairland 14-4 and led 36-12 after a layup by Reid off a nice pass from Allen.

Ava Layne hit a trifecta for Fairland but Hayven Carter made a layup and Allen hit a 17-footer at the buzzer and the lead was 40-15 at the break.

Layne converted a 3-point play at the 4:40mark of the third quarter and it was 46-23 only to have Reid hit a baseline jumper and Woods a layup for a 52-25 lead and the Lady Trojans were never threatened.
